微信小程序是一种轻量级的应用程序,与传统的 App 相比,它更加轻便快捷,无需下载、无需安装,采用即用即走的方式,方便用户随时使用。微信小程序的应用场景非常广泛,比如在线购物、生活服务、餐饮美食、社交娱乐等等。要开发一个微信小程序,首先需要使用微信小程序开发工具进行开发。针对这些场景,我将带您一起了解微信小程序开发工具的使用技巧。
一、微信小程序工具的使用
1.安装微信开发者工具
微信小程序开发工具是一款基于 Mac 和 Windows 系统的开发工具,您可以在微信官方网站上下载到这个工具。根据您的系统类型,选择相应的版本进行安装即可。
2.创建小程序项目
打开微信开发者工具后,进入新建项目页面,填入小程序的名称、AppID 和项目所在的本地路径。点击“创建”后,即可自动生成一份小程序的默认模板。
3.项目结构介绍
在微信小程序工具中,项目结构采用了 WXML、WXSS 和 JS 文件的方式进行组织。其中,WXML 用于描述小程序的结构,WXSS 用于定义小程序的样式风格,而 JS 文件则用于实现小程序的逻辑功能。
二、微信小程序工具的调试技巧
1.使用调试工具栏
微信小程序开发工具提供了调试工具栏,可以帮助开发者更快捷地进行调试。这些工具包括控制台、调试器、性能分析器等,可以帮助开发者进行调试,检查程序中的错误和问题。
2.使用模拟器
微信小程序开发工具中还集成了模拟器,用于模拟小程序在真实设备上的运行情况。当开发者进行页面设计时,可以在模拟器中查看页面的布局效果、动画效果等等,以便更好地定位和排查问题。
3.使用网络调试工具
微信小程序开发工具中也集成了网络调试工具,可以较为准确地模拟小程序在不同网络环境下的运行情况。通过使用该工具,开发者可以检查小程序在不同网络环境下的性能表现,以便更好地进行优化和调试。
三、微信小程序工具的优化技巧
1.提高页面加载速度
对于小程序来说,页面加载速度非常关键。如果页面加载速度过慢,会对用户体验造成不良影响,从而导致用户之间的流失。因此,在进行小程序开发时,应尽量采用高性能的组件和技术,以提高小程序的页面加载速度。
2.降低小程序的内存占用
在小程序运行时,经常会出现内存占用过高的情况。此时,开发者需要采用一些技术手段,以减少小程序的内存占用。比如,可以采用图片的延迟加载和瀑布流布局,以限制图片的数量和尺寸,从而减少内存占用。
3.移除冗余的代码
在小程序开发过程中,开发者可能会编写一些不必要的代码,这些代码不仅增加了小程序的体积,还降低了小程序的性能和速度。因此,开发者需要及时清理冗余的代码,以减少小程序的体积和内存占用。
总之,在进行微信小程序开发时,开发者需要熟练掌握微信小程序开发工具的使用技巧,以便更好地进行小程序的开发和调试。同时,还需要不断地进行优化和改进,以提高小程序的性能和用户体验。